#c61cd4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c61cd4 is composed of 77.6% red, 11% green and 83.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 6.6% cyan, 86.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 295.4 degrees, a saturation of 76.7% and a lightness of 47.1%. #c61cd4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ff38ff with #8d00a9. Closest websafe color is: #cc33cc.

Shades and Tints of #c61cd4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040104 is the darkest color, while #fcf2f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#c61cd4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#806f81 is the less saturated color, while #dd00f0 is the most saturated one.
